Pradhan Mantri Surakshit Matritva Abhiyan (PMSMA) –A Decade of Safe Motherhood
Launched in 2016, the Pradhan Mantri Surakshit Matritva Abhiyan (PMSMA) reflects India’s unwavering commitment to ensuring that every pregnant woman receives quality antenatal care and timely specialist support during pregnancy.
The programme is organized on the 9th day of every month as a dedicated day for comprehensive antenatal care services, enabling early identification and management of high-risk pregnancies and strengthening the journey towards safe motherhood. Over the past decade, PMSMA has evolved into a nationwide movement that has brought quality antenatal services closer to women and strengthened the continuum of care for mothers and newborns across the country
The commemorative coin of Rs. 75 embodies care, protection and hope. The number “9” represents both the fixed day of service delivery under PMSMA and the nine months of pregnancy, reflecting the programme’s commitment to supporting women throughout their maternal journey. The coin pays tribute to the resilience of mothers and the dedication of doctors, nurses, ANMs, ASHAs and healthcare workers who work tirelessly to safeguard two lives at a time.
The Government of India proudly releases this commemorative coin of Rs .75 marking ten years of PMSMA. The coin honours a decade of collective commitment towards safe motherhood and celebrates the efforts of all stakeholders who continue to make motherhood safer and provide every newborn a healthier start to life.
